Alumni Spotlight: Meet Dr. Alan Peterson 🎓

From a military upbringing to leading one of the world’s largest trauma research networks, Dr. Alan Peterson ’86 & ’90 has built a career rooted in service, science, and impact. A retired U.S. Air Force clinical psychologist, he has dedicated over two decades to supporting service members and advancing the treatment of trauma-related conditions.

Discover how Dr. Peterson’s NSU experience, shaped by hands-on mentorship and real-world application helped launch a career that would go on to establish the STRONG STAR Consortium, secure over $250 million in research funding, and transform the way PTSD and related conditions are understood and treated worldwide.

With hundreds of publications, global presentations, and a continued commitment to giving back, Dr. Peterson exemplifies what it means to lead with purpose and make a lasting difference. This May, he’ll return to inspire the next generation as an NSU Commencement speaker.

Join the NSU Alumni Association for our upcoming Lunch & Learn on May 7 from 12–1 PM (EST): Understanding and Supporting our Nation’s Veterans and Their Families: Lessons Learned from a Lifelong Military Brat, Service Member, and Veteran.

Hear from NSU alumnus Alan L. Peterson '86 & '90, Ph.D., a professor at the University of Texas at San Antonio, research health scientist at the South Texas Veterans Health Care System, and Director of the STRONG STAR Consortium.

In this session, Dr. Peterson will share key lessons from his personal and professional journey, offering valuable insights to help attendees better understand and support our nation’s veterans and their families.
